On April 27, 2025, within the framework of the project “Promoting Youth Participation in Lori: Increasing Civic Engagement at Local and Regional Levels,” trainer Davit Hakobyan conducted a workshop on communication, public speaking, and project management for the youth of Gyulagarak community.
During the workshop, participants learned about the essence of project management and its key implementation stages, gaining vital practical knowledge for turning their ideas into actual programs. In the second half of the day, five working groups were formed to map and identify the primary issues concerning the youth in the Gyulagarak community. Participants noted that the skills gained, particularly in project management, would be highly beneficial for their upcoming community initiatives.
This event was implemented with the support of the “EU4Youth: Youth Engagement and Empowerment” project, operating under the “Strengthening Civil Society in the Eastern Partnership Countries” program, co-funded by the German Government and the European Union.
